| Aspect | Crown Molding | Carpentry |
|---|
| Required Skills | Precise measuring, cutting, and installing decorative moldings | Broader skills including framing, cabinetry, and structural work |
| Work Environment | Interior finishing projects, residential and commercial spaces | Varied environments including framing, remodeling, and custom builds |
| Certifications | None typically required, but certifications in carpentry or finishing can help | Carpentry licenses or certifications often preferred |
While crown molding is a specialized aspect of carpentry focused on decorative interior trim, carpentry encompasses a wide range of construction and finishing skills. Crown molding professionals often work within carpentry but specialize in decorative moldings, making their roles distinct yet related.
